Pu Blackhead Mourns Junior Colleague Re McDonald, Revealing Over 20 Years of Close Bond

Yesterday (25 Aug 2026 GMT+7) Pu Blackhead senior industry colleagues came to attend the memorial service Re McDonald at Wat Yang On Nut on the final night, sharing feelings and memories of their junior colleague, praising Re as a person who was consistent and always had clear goals in life

They bonded even before entering the industry, and Pu and Re have a shared history spanning over 20 years. They first met before Pu formed the Blackhead band and before Re began acting or hosting his own show. Back then, there were groups of young people—Re’s group and Pu’s group of older seniors. When they went out or socialized, they often gathered at a place called “Hoi Hoi,” which was like a home base and a central meeting point for everyone before heading home.

Recalling their last meeting on the talk show “Tid Khuay,” Pu said they had a chance to talk on the show, and Re could still remember old moments better than Pu himself, despite Pu being older. Re had a very good memory and paid close attention to details. On their last meeting, Pu confirmed that he saw no signs of illness or abnormal behavior from Re. He remained cheerful, playful, and thoughtful as usual. After the show, they never met in person again but did have a video call when Re visited mutual friends. They even talked about planning a trip together, but their schedules never aligned. When Pu heard the sad news, he had to call close senior friends of Re to confirm, thinking it might be false news. Pu was in Japan for work when he learned of Re’s death; after confirmation, he felt shocked and deeply saddened.

If defining Re’s character, Pu described him as consistently steadfast, with firm goals and determination, never distracted by anything else. Everything Re thought about and chose to do was positive and good. Finally, Pu sent a message to his dear friend: Everything you intended started well, and though you have now passed, this is not the end. Friends and those around you will continue to carry on your intentions. May you rest peacefully without any worries.
